Jane Cynthia Clark was born in Winston, Alabama, USA in 1819, to John B Clark and Sarah "Sally" Runners. Later in life, Jane Cynthia Clark married William Murry Hubbard; among their children were Palmira Hubbard, Eliza T. Hubbard, California Faye Hubbard, William Lee Hubbard, W. E. Hubbard, A.G. Copeland Hubbard, Thomas H. Hubbard, Sarah Elizabeth Hubbard and Mary Frances Hubbard. Jane Cynthia Clark died in Lawrence County, Alabama, USA, 1900.
